The Sun - A Kmad Short Story
I wrote this a while ago, and just found it again, I dusted it off with some editting. hope ya like it!

Juno hated the sun.

He hated it with every fiber of his being, with every hot mouthful of air he was able to breathe, and with every warm droplet of blood that ran down his scorching body and landed onto the dry ground.

His normally soft skin was rough and blistery, with long deep gashes that cracked open due to the dry air and hot, hot sun. He hated the pain, but neither his body, nor his will power would let him die. He hated how he was still alive, forced to live wallowing in his own blood and filth, while insects came and infected his wounds. He feebly tried to swap at one particular bug that kept biting, but to no avail. He stared off a bit, and though his vision was hindered by the sun, he was sure the pack of predators watching him was no mirage.

All this though was nothing compared to the overbearing sun. The sun that continually barbequed his flesh, and cracked open fresh spots on his body, each time causing him immense pain. His throat was dry and he screamed for water, but there was none to be found in this merciless hell hole.

He thought that he could survive without the sun, but the sun saved him everyday. The hot blistery sun saved him from the sub zero night temperature that threatened to freeze Juno solid. At first he embraced the cold, as it lowered his temperature and allowed him some respite from the heat. But then, when icicles formed from the sweat on his brow, when the very blood around him started to freeze over, he longed again for the blistery sun. But when the sun came again and warmed him, it became the hell it once was. Though it saved him from the cold each day, it constantly tortured him.

The only thing that Juno could think to do was to curse the people who did this to him. He was a hired mercenary. He was hired by the USA to kill the new Iraqi president, in order that their guy might step up and lead. Too bad he was found out, and was forced to flee. Too bad the USA needed to cover this up, so they “took care of him.” His country, his beloved motherland betrayed his. They sent soldiers to kill him. The gunshot did not do it, and neither did the knife stab. So they took him to this desolate place, and left him to rot and die. They were laughing when they did it. They were laughing hard, and calling him a traitor to the American cause. If only they knew the truth. His beloved country had betrayed me. The love of his life... gone.

The sun reached its zenith, and like everyday, he could not help but wiggle and squirm to try and find some respite from the overbearing heat. No matter which way he was, the heat continually berated him. It was if a demon had come to torture him. He wished to die badly, but his body would not relinquish his soul. He could even see the demon. Wild eyed, happy at his pain. He could not take it any more. With inhuman strength he lunged at the demon. He chased the demon over the sand dunes, not even feeling what was happening to his dying form. Finally, he jumped at the demon, but fell headfirst into the sand. The demon disappeared.

In front of him, Juno could see an oasis. He thought it was a mirage, but when he reached forward to ward it away, him hand became immersed in the cool water. He rolled over, and submerged into the coolness, taking his fill of drink. He heard the demon laughing again, and he waved at it, before it disappeared.

Juno loved the sun.
